Hot air oven |
170 degrees 1 hour 160 degrees 2 hours Bacillus atropheus Niger, CL. Tetani |
|
Incineration |
600-800 degrees |
|
Pasteurization |
63 degrees - 30 minutes 72 degrees - 20 seconds, cool to 13 degrees |
|
Inspissation |
85 degrees for 30 minutes for 3 days |
|
Vaccine bath |
60 degrees for 30 minutes |
|
Tyndallisation |
100 degrees for 20 minutes for 3 days |
|
Autoclave |
121 degrees at 15 psi for 15 minutes
Flash - 134 degrees for 3 minutes
|
|
Cold sterilization |
2.5 kilorads of gamma radiation QC - Bacillus pumilis |
|
Membrane filter |
0.22 microns |
|
HEPA filter |
0.3 microns |
|
Quality control for filters |
Serratia Bremundimonas diminuta |
|
Alcohol |
70%, protein coagulation |
|
Formaldehyde |
40% formalin, alkylator |
|
Glutaraldehyde |
2% 3 hours - spores 20 minutes - vegetative forms |
|
Lysol/cresol |
5%, cell membrane damage |
|
Chlorhexidine/chloroxylenol |
1-4%, cell membrane damage |
|
Chlorine |
0.5-5% (hypochlorite), oxidising agent |
|
Iodine |
10% (iodophore) |
|
Mercury |
Less than 1% (thiomersal), inactivation of bacterial proteins |
|
Silver |
1% (sulphadiazine), inactivation of bacterial proteins |
|
Ethylene oxide with carbon dioxide |
30-65 degrees for 8-12 hours, causes DNA damage; QC- Bacillus atropheus globigi |
|
Peroxide |
3.5% - debridement 35% - disinfection; causes DNA damage |
|
Dettol |
Chloroxylenol |
|
Savlon |
Cetrimide (Cetavlon) with chlorhexidine |
